Mumbai : “It is our duty to register a case based on Rhea Chakraborty’s complaint against Sushant Singh Rajput’s two sisters Priyanka and Meetu in connection with the death of late Bollywood actor Sushant Singh Rajput,” Mumbai Police said in an affidavit filed in a court here on Monday.

The CBI has registered a case against Sushant’s friend Rhea for inciting Sushant to commit suicide. On September 7, Rhea lodged a case against Sushant’s sister Priyanka and Meetu with the Mumbai Police. According to her complaint, the duo had given Sushant a prescription for drugs banned under the NDPS Act from doctors at Ram Manohar Lohia Hospital in Delhi. Both then filed a petition in the High Court seeking quashing of the case against them.

However, the CBI said the allegations against Sushant’s sisters were not factual and that Rhea’s allegations were fabricated. So, the Mumbai Police has rejected the allegations made by the sisters opposing the petition filed by Sushant’s sisters. “We are not tarnishing the image of them or the deceased and are not obstructing the CBI’s investigation,” the Mumbai police said in an affidavit.
